Hey Fedi, I'm curious, where does the distinction between arcane n divine magic (i.e. mages and clerics) originate from? Was't DnD, or sth that predates it?

A lotta fantasy staples can be traced back'a Tolkien's works, but the wizards there all had religious significance (they were Maiar, effectively low-ranking angels), so I don't think the arcane/divine dichotomy was already present there (the magic was often less concrete n more mystical anyway). But a lotta modern fantasy works, notably DnD, various RPGs n RPG-inspired anime etc. have such a distinction. So, what was the first thing that introduced't?
